What does a typical day look like for an AS400 Developer?

A typical day for an AS400 Developer involves writing, testing, and troubleshooting code in RPG, COBOL, or CL for business-critical applications running on IBM iSeries systems. Developers often work closely with business analysts, system administrators, and other IT professionals to gather requirements, implement system enhancements, and ensure data integrity within DB2 databases. Daily tasks may also include resolving production issues, performing regular maintenance, and participating in code reviews or deployment planning. Collaborative work and clear communication are common, as developers typically play an integral role in supporting both legacy and modernized business processes.

What is an AS400 developer?

An AS400 developer is a software professional who specializes in creating, maintaining, and modifying applications on the IBM iSeries (AS/400) platform. They typically work with languages like RPG, COBOL, and CL programming, and may also handle database management and system integration tasks within a mainframe or enterprise environment.

What coding language does AS400 use?

AS400, now known as IBM i, primarily uses the RPG (Report Program Generator) language for application development. It also supports COBOL, CL (Control Language), and SQL for database management and scripting tasks, making it a versatile environment for developers working on enterprise systems.

Is AS400 still used?

AS400, also known as IBM iSeries, is still used in many organizations for legacy business applications, especially in industries like finance and manufacturing. AS400 developers maintain and update these systems, often working with tools like RPG and CL, and the platform continues to receive updates and support from IBM.
